Precision Over Guesswork: How Biomarker Testing Is Revolutionizing Personalized ED Treatment

For decades, the clinical approach to erectile dysfunction followed a relatively straightforward script: a man reports difficulty achieving or maintaining an erection, a physician prescribes a phosphodiesterase type 5 (PDE5) inhibitor, and the patient waits to see if it works. If it does not, adjustments are made—sometimes over months of trial and error. This model, while not without merit, treats ED as a uniform condition rather than the physiologically complex, highly individualized disorder that modern science increasingly recognizes it to be.

Today, a growing number of urologists and men's health specialists across the United States are moving toward a fundamentally different paradigm—one grounded in biomarker-driven diagnostics and precision medicine. The implications for treatment selection, medication efficacy, and long-term outcomes are substantial.

Why One-Size-Fits-All Prescribing Falls Short

Erectile dysfunction is not a single disease. It is a symptom—one that can arise from vascular insufficiency, hormonal dysregulation, neurological impairment, psychological factors, or some combination thereof. Prescribing the same first-line therapy to a man whose ED stems from endothelial dysfunction as to one whose condition is rooted in low testosterone or autonomic nerve damage is, at best, imprecise. At worst, it delays effective treatment and erodes patient confidence.

Statistics reflect this reality. Studies suggest that approximately 30 to 35 percent of men do not respond adequately to their initial PDE5 inhibitor prescription. A significant portion of those non-responders may not have been properly evaluated for underlying causes before the prescription was written. Biomarker testing is emerging as the diagnostic bridge that closes this gap.

The Key Biomarkers Shaping Modern ED Diagnosis

Cardiovascular and Endothelial Markers

The penile vasculature is, in many respects, a sensitive early-warning system for broader cardiovascular health. Reduced blood flow to erectile tissue frequently mirrors similar impairments elsewhere in the body. For this reason, markers such as high-sensitivity C-reactive protein (hs-CRP), homocysteine levels, and lipid panel components—particularly HDL cholesterol and triglycerides—are now being incorporated into comprehensive ED evaluations.

Endothelial function testing, including flow-mediated dilation (FMD) assessments, provides a more direct measurement of how well blood vessels dilate in response to increased blood flow. Men with compromised endothelial function may respond differently to PDE5 inhibitors than those with intact vascular architecture, and this distinction can meaningfully inform prescribing decisions.

Hormonal Panels

Testosterone deficiency is among the most commonly overlooked contributors to ED in American men, particularly those over 45. A comprehensive hormonal workup extends well beyond a simple total testosterone reading. Free testosterone, sex hormone-binding globulin (SHBG), luteinizing hormone (LH), follicle-stimulating hormone (FSH), estradiol, prolactin, and thyroid function markers all contribute to a fuller picture of hormonal health.

Elevated prolactin levels, for instance, can suppress testosterone production and impair libido in ways that no PDE5 inhibitor will adequately address. Similarly, men with secondary hypogonadism—where the problem originates in the pituitary rather than the testes—may require entirely different therapeutic interventions. Identifying these distinctions before initiating treatment prevents months of ineffective therapy.

Metabolic Markers

Insulin resistance and type 2 diabetes are among the most significant risk factors for ED, and their relationship with treatment response is well-documented. Fasting glucose, hemoglobin A1c (HbA1c), and fasting insulin levels help clinicians assess the degree to which metabolic dysfunction may be contributing to erectile impairment. Men with poorly controlled blood sugar often experience reduced responsiveness to standard pharmacological treatments until glycemic control is improved.

Vascular Function Assessments

Beyond blood panels, penile Doppler ultrasound remains one of the most informative diagnostic tools available. By measuring arterial blood flow velocity within the penile vasculature before and after pharmacological stimulation, this assessment can differentiate between arteriogenic ED—caused by insufficient arterial inflow—and venogenic ED, which involves inadequate venous occlusion. This distinction is clinically significant: arteriogenic ED may respond well to PDE5 inhibitors, while venogenic ED may require alternative approaches, including low-intensity shockwave therapy or surgical consultation.

How Biomarker Profiles Predict Medication Response

The emerging field of pharmacogenomics adds another layer of personalization. Genetic variants affecting CYP3A4 enzyme activity—the primary metabolic pathway for most PDE5 inhibitors—can influence how quickly a medication is processed in the body, affecting both efficacy and the likelihood of side effects. While routine pharmacogenomic testing for ED is not yet standard practice in most US clinical settings, early research suggests it may one day help determine optimal dosing and drug selection with greater accuracy.

Some research also indicates that baseline nitric oxide bioavailability—measurable through plasma nitrite and nitrate levels—predicts how robustly a patient's vascular system will respond to PDE5 inhibition. Since these medications work by amplifying the nitric oxide signaling pathway, men with severely depleted nitric oxide production may see limited benefit from even optimal dosing.

The Broader Picture: ED as a Window Into Systemic Health

One of the most compelling arguments for biomarker-driven ED evaluation is that the findings rarely stop at erectile function. Diagnosing subclinical cardiovascular disease, undetected hypogonadism, or early-stage insulin resistance in the context of an ED workup can have life-altering implications that extend well beyond the bedroom. In this sense, a thorough diagnostic evaluation is not merely a pathway to better treatment selection—it is an investment in comprehensive male health.
